Video Poker Machines

Video poker is a blending of slot machines and the game of Poker. Even though the game relies on the help of technology, it keeps the original poker game in essence. The game is a man vs. computer battle. Here, the poker enthusiast is playing with the computer instead of with other gamblers. Interestingly though, the ultimate goal remains the same.

An uncomplicated and agreeable game, video poker is exceptionally liked among players of any age. The selection of video poker games in casinos has grown at a fast rate. The number of game varieties has also grown substantially. Some casinos even have a few electronic poker games on a single machine. These machines can host around five players at the same time. The amazing growth of web video poker games provides the player with limitless choices. In fact, several players like betting against machines in place of a actual person. The incredible growth of electronic poker machines can be tied to these factors.

When compared to slot machines, electronic poker is a little different. The bettor is required to hit the high-paying hands to leave as a champ. 95 to one hundred percent of the cash played is given back to the enthusiast in almost all of the video poker machines. Although, there is a five% likelihood of losing the money, and that can be damaging in most cases. This is because most people are inclined not to wager on just a single hand.

A player cannot count on all her winning opportunities to be converted into money. Apart from a proper understanding of the game, the player has to build her own way to come out ahead. Despite the fact that it does not take long to pickup the game, selection of the proper machine is incredibly important.
